SIZE
The finished eucalyptus branch measures approx. 40-45 cm (16-18 inches) in length, but the length can easily be adjusted to your preference. The leaves measure approx. 1.5-2.5 cm (0.6-1 inch) in diameter.
YARN
The branch is made using 8/4 cotton yarn. You can use any brand you like, but this pattern was made using Hjertegarn Cotton No. 8.
For one branch you will need approximately:
- Light green: approx. 8 g
Note: You can use any cotton yarn with a similar weight. Using different yarn or hook sizes will change both the finished size and yarn consumption.
YOU WILL ALSO NEED
- 1 thick floral wire, 30 cm (11.8 inches), 2 mm thick
- 1 thin floral wire, 30 cm (11.8 inches), 0.6 mm thick
- Hot glue gun
CROCHET HOOK
2.0 mm (US B-1)
If you normally use a different hook size with your chosen yarn, you can do so. Please note that the finished size and yarn usage may vary. Check your gauge if needed.
CROCHET GAUGE
10 cm (4 inches) = 24 single crochet stitches
If you have fewer than 24 stitches over 10 cm, use a smaller hook.
If you have more than 24 stitches over 10 cm, use a larger hook.
